[0013] Such as figure 1 , an embodiment of the present invention provides a typical distribution network networking block diagram, on this basis, the networking architecture proposed by the present invention is applicable, and the specific implementation process is as follows:
[0014] An autonomous networking system based on TMDA power automation terminals, including terminals and station terminals that perform information interaction through time-division multiple access. There are multiple terminals, and time-division multiple Synchronous clock source; each terminal in the autonomous networking system is identified by a unique coded ID.
